    A lion-headed goddess

    Sekhmet was one of the most powerful Egyptian deities. She was viewed as a strong and powerful goddess and was also known as a warrior goddess. The character and destiny of Sekhmet were reflected in her appearance: she was portrayed as a lion-headed woman. This is also how she is portrayed on our coin. The coin shows the goddess, ancient Egyptian writings on a golden background, and a cat, which is an important symbol in Egyptian culture. There are many myths and stories about the warrior goddess Sekhmet. She was portrayed wearing red clothes because she was very fierce and merciless. Legends say that Sekhmet herself was born out of rage when the Sun God Ra, enraged with humanity, wanted to punish people and sent the Eye of Ra to the earth. This is how Sekhmet was born. When she was on earth, she would be merciless to people and would drink their blood.

     

    A healing goddess

    This is just one part of the legend, however. Other stories say that Sekhmet was also a very merciful deity. She is also said to have had healing powers. When people treated her in a respectful manner, she would protect them against serious diseases. It is also said that she was even able to treat broken bones.
